Finance Review Summary — Gross-Margin Review

For heads of department at Corvane Supplies. Gross margin for the half-year stands at 31.4%, down one point on plan, driven by freight costs in the Hallowmere region. Product mix otherwise favourable. Corrective pricing actions take effect next month. The underlying business plan note appears directly below.

confidential, bagep-bagag: The renewal with Druathax Group closes at $10 million a year, 10 percent below the last contract. Project Zorael slips by a full year because of the staffing delay.

Handover — Vexler partner SFTP drop

Ownership moves to you today. Drop runs hourly from Vexler's end into the intake bucket via the relay host. Watch for zero-byte files; their exporter flakes on Mondays. Creds live in the ops vault, path noted in the runbook. Vault auto-seals after 48h idle. Support escalations go to the on-call rotation, not me. If the vault is sealed when you need it, unseal with the recovery passphrase below.

recovery phrase for tadug-fafof: zorwyn-kasion

## Artifact Signing — StageGrid Seat-Map Renderer

All builds of the StageGrid renderer used by the Orpheum Pavilion box office must be signed before deploy. The CI pipeline at Velvetline produces a tarball of the WebGL bundle, computes its digest, and attaches a detached signature. Unsigned artifacts are rejected by the venue kiosk updater, which caused last Tuesday's rollback. Verification happens at install time against the pinned public key. For the weekly sync, note that the current signing key is as follows.

release key, bajep-fahap: bky3_pY3

TURN-208: Gatevale turnstile counters at the Merrow Field pilot double-count when a rotation reverses mid-cycle. Attendance totals drift roughly 2% high per event. The debounce window fix is implemented, reviewed by Ilsa, and soak-tested across two simulated match days without drift. Ready for your cut; the candidate build is identified below.

trace token, tagag-tafog: htk6_5ed18c

**Vendor note: Inkmill markdown pipeline**

Rendering for Parchway docs is outsourced to Inkmill under an annual contract, renewing each March. They handle sanitization and PDF export; we own the upload queue. SLA: 4-hour response on rendering failures. Escalate only after two failed retries. Their support desk is reachable at the address below.

billing contact of hahaf-baguf = zorael.tammir.jorius@sivrelhq.internal